    Kelly T.

    Formerly the space where Three Sheets converted an old motel into a cool quaint venue, the Habibi brings the love too! Lots of great craft beer options and many of them local. I heard they were doing a Juxta Nomad collab soon too (iykyk). Super hip atmosphere mostly outside with a cozy patio that has heaters. They had a really local taco guy from Salsa Blazo post up the night I went. Like you can't get these tacos just anywhere, and they were BOMB! You can also get a shesha (hooka) which is so refreshing to have on a space that isn't a cheesey night club somewhere. They've just had their soft opening and are waiting on some more licensing to expand the upstairs. Can't wait to see what they do!

    Katie D.

    Hola Habibi has an amazing patio space and an even better staff! We came for a bar crawl and despite some miscommunication between the crawl and Habibi, Jose took incredible care of us and left us with a fantastic experience. Downstairs is a more upbeat vibe with a fantastic beer menu on tap, upstairs is a speakeasy which was an incredible chill and romantic space. There was a singer (shout out State Flower) who played live for us and the mixologists upstairs and downstairs not only created an amazing menu but served the drinks great. I can't wait to go back, both downstairs and upstairs.

    It's like stepping back to the seventies. It was Déjà vu until I realized there was no cigarette…read moresmoke and the carpet wasn't sticky from stale spilled drinks. The decor is perfect for a trip through time. There's a huge variety of beer between the on tap and bottled. It's the old school order at the bar and take your drinks to the table. Bartender was friendly, helpful, and knowledgeable. The beer was served in the proper glassware. The decor has an incredible number of vintage signs, promotional displays, clocks, etc. some for beer brands no longer made. There is also a huge beer can collection. It's a very nice breaking from blinding flashing lights and loud music. Tip: From the outside you will think you're on the wrong street. There's no sign, flashing lights, folding message boards, etc. Open the door by the 222 and step into yesteryear with a modern supply chain. It's worth a visit.
